新聞中心
MaxCompute實(shí)時(shí)同步支持處理半路開(kāi)啟binlog,確保數(shù)據(jù)的完整性和一致性。
大數(shù)據(jù)計(jì)算MaxCompute的實(shí)時(shí)同步功能確實(shí)存在處理半路才開(kāi)binlog的情況,以下是關(guān)于這個(gè)問(wèn)題的詳細(xì)解釋:

創(chuàng)新互聯(lián)建站是一家專注于成都網(wǎng)站設(shè)計(jì)、網(wǎng)站制作與策劃設(shè)計(jì),閩侯網(wǎng)站建設(shè)哪家好?創(chuàng)新互聯(lián)建站做網(wǎng)站,專注于網(wǎng)站建設(shè)10年,網(wǎng)設(shè)計(jì)領(lǐng)域的專業(yè)建站公司;建站業(yè)務(wù)涵蓋:閩侯等地區(qū)。閩侯做網(wǎng)站價(jià)格咨詢:18980820575
1、什么是binlog?
binlog是MySQL數(shù)據(jù)庫(kù)中的一種二進(jìn)制日志文件,用于記錄數(shù)據(jù)庫(kù)的所有更改操作,當(dāng)數(shù)據(jù)庫(kù)發(fā)生更改時(shí),binlog會(huì)記錄這些更改,以便在需要時(shí)進(jìn)行恢復(fù)或同步。
2、MaxCompute實(shí)時(shí)同步的原理
MaxCompute實(shí)時(shí)同步是通過(guò)讀取源數(shù)據(jù)庫(kù)的binlog來(lái)實(shí)現(xiàn)的,當(dāng)源數(shù)據(jù)庫(kù)發(fā)生更改時(shí),MaxCompute會(huì)捕獲這些更改,并將它們應(yīng)用到目標(biāo)數(shù)據(jù)庫(kù)中,這樣,目標(biāo)數(shù)據(jù)庫(kù)就可以保持與源數(shù)據(jù)庫(kù)的同步狀態(tài)。
3、處理半路才開(kāi)binlog的情況
在某些情況下,源數(shù)據(jù)庫(kù)可能沒(méi)有開(kāi)啟binlog功能,或者在實(shí)時(shí)同步過(guò)程中突然關(guān)閉了binlog功能,這種情況下,MaxCompute實(shí)時(shí)同步可能會(huì)遇到問(wèn)題,因?yàn)樗鼰o(wú)法獲取到源數(shù)據(jù)庫(kù)的更改信息。
4、如何處理這種情況?
為了解決這個(gè)問(wèn)題,可以采取以下措施:
在開(kāi)始實(shí)時(shí)同步之前,確保源數(shù)據(jù)庫(kù)已經(jīng)開(kāi)啟了binlog功能,如果源數(shù)據(jù)庫(kù)沒(méi)有開(kāi)啟binlog功能,可以在實(shí)時(shí)同步之前手動(dòng)開(kāi)啟它。
在實(shí)時(shí)同步過(guò)程中,確保源數(shù)據(jù)庫(kù)的binlog功能一直處于開(kāi)啟狀態(tài),如果源數(shù)據(jù)庫(kù)在實(shí)時(shí)同步過(guò)程中突然關(guān)閉了binlog功能,可以手動(dòng)重新開(kāi)啟它。
如果源數(shù)據(jù)庫(kù)在實(shí)時(shí)同步過(guò)程中出現(xiàn)了問(wèn)題,導(dǎo)致binlog功能無(wú)法正常工作,可以嘗試重啟源數(shù)據(jù)庫(kù),以恢復(fù)binlog功能的正常運(yùn)作。
5、歸納
雖然MaxCompute實(shí)時(shí)同步存在處理半路才開(kāi)binlog的情況,但通過(guò)采取相應(yīng)的措施,可以確保實(shí)時(shí)同步過(guò)程的順利進(jìn)行,在實(shí)際應(yīng)用中,需要密切關(guān)注源數(shù)據(jù)庫(kù)的狀態(tài),并及時(shí)處理可能出現(xiàn)的問(wèn)題。
本文名稱:大數(shù)據(jù)計(jì)算MaxCompute這個(gè)實(shí)時(shí)同步有處理半路才開(kāi)binlog這種情況嗎?
本文網(wǎng)址:http://www.dlmjj.cn/article/djiocsd.html


咨詢
建站咨詢
